ESS Works With Mental Health First Aid England to Train 100+ Mental Health First Aiders

News

ESS, the Defence, Energy and Government Services sector of Compass Group UK & Ireland, has worked with Mental Health First Aid England to introduce mental health first aiders across its business. More than 100 colleagues have completed the training over the past 18 months, with the last cohort containing the hundredth volunteer!

Team members from the frontline through to senior leadership have taken part with the aim of promoting mental wellbeing and encouraging open, honest conversations about mental health in their workplaces. Many cited the positive impact of a friendly face at work as their reason for getting involved.

The course, delivered in collaboration with Mental Health First Aid England, provides attendees with an understanding of mental health conditions and strategies to help those who may be struggling, including listening and signposting to support. Following certification, the mental health first aiders join monthly check-in calls to aid them in their role. The plan is to continue growing and evolving the community, with more training scheduled for later this year and into 2022.   

The mental health first aid programme forms part of ESS’ wider wellbeing strategy which comprises four pillars; Healthier Mind, Healthier Body, Healthier Food and Healthier World. The company’s nutrition and wellbeing team promote mental and physical health and sustainability through regular activities including wellness webinars and mindful moments sessions, as well as a monthly wellness newsletter.
